What I read last month.

This month, of particular interest to Kosters, I review Better Off Without 'Em, Chuck Thompson's controversial manifesto encouraging Southern secession.

In keeping with my yearlong concentration on the Medieval period, I look at the Institutes of Justinian. And, since I've reached the period of the Islamic zenith, where Arabic culture eclipsed Europe during the "Dark Ages", I have a few more Arab-centric works, including The Arabian Nights, Among the Believers, and The Crusades Through Arab Eyes.  Plus the usual novels, old and new, European and American, literary and murder mysteries, and an autobiography of the young math genius Sarah Flannery. And finally, a book that many had been looking forward to my review of, given my user name: Bujold's Cryoburn.  Enjoy!
